Final Fantasy 15 and Battleborn Get Crossover Artwork

Final Fantasy XV and Battleborn are very different games–in terms of genre and art design, among other things–but now they’ve been brought together. As part of an “art trade,” the art directors at Square Enix and Gearbox Software have created some crossover artwork that is certainly unique.

First up is Yusuke Naora’s take on Battleborn. Take a look:

Battleborn art director Scott Kester’s image, meanwhile, shows off a stylized version of Final Fantasy XV hero Noctis, with Battleborn character Phoebe in the background. Also very cool.

These images were shared recently on Twitter by the official Gearbox and Final Fantasy XV accounts (via DualShockers). Gearbox called Naora’s piece “amazing,” while Square Enix said Kester’s is “badass.”

Battleborn launched earlier this month for consoles and PC, while Final Fantasy XV is scheduled to come out in September. Gearbox’s game is off to an “encouraging” start, but it’s too soon to say if the shooter will become a Borderlands-like hit, according to Take-Two CEO Strauss Zelnick.

As for Final Fantasy XV, director Hajime Tabata said he’s hopeful the game can sell 10 million copies.
